Continue ReadingRosemount guard Caleb Siwek Caleb Siwek 6'1" | SG Rosemount | 2022 State MN took his team to the State Tournament this year averaging 20 points a game, and has helped Howard Pulley to a 14-7 record this spring. Siwek is also taking advantage of June being open for recruiting visits so he’s taken a couple trips this month.
Caleb is one of the elite shooters in the state of Minnesota. He’s a consistent scorer that hits consistently, and he really makes teams pay in the clutch (hit two game winners against Lakeville South this season). In addition to that shooting touch, Siwek is competitive, has a great feel for the game, and knows how to get open for his shot with or without the basketball.
“I’ve already visited Minnesota-Duluth, and today I went to Concordia-St. Paul,” Caleb told Prep Hoops. “As of right now, I’m hoping to get to Bemidji State, St. Thomas, Nebraska-Omaha, and possibly North Dakota.”
UMD previously offered Siwek and while at CSP, the Golden Bears staff gave Siwek a scholarship offer. How were the visits?
“UMD had a very nice campus, with very nice facilities,” Siwek told Prep Hoops. “The coaching staff up there is terrific. They have completely flipped the program around, and have a very good vision for years to come. It also doesn’t hurt that it’s in Duluth.”
As for Concordia-St. Paul…
“For CSP, I loved the renovations they were making, specifically to their basketball arena. The coaching staff is awesome, and they don’t sugarcoat anything, they tell you as it is. I love the offense that Coach Fletch has them running, and I think it fits my game perfectly. The location is also ideal right in the middle of St. Paul.”
